Sam
c2cfbce9ce
automatically updating times for posts on topic
...
moved moment.js into localization file (we need to localize it)
added helpers for date formatting use, moment().shortDate() moment().longDate() moment().shortDateNoYear()
2013-06-11 17:25:50 +10:00
Sam
6d85dc1724
bring in unread items to "latest" as well as new items.
2013-06-11 15:51:43 +10:00
Sam
4d7a520a8c
don't render 0 ... also this file needs some love
2013-06-11 15:27:26 +10:00
Sam
4e01b84695
fix digest
2013-06-11 15:27:26 +10:00
Sam
fa8a84f20c
removed sugar.js, port functionality to moment and underscore.js
...
bring in latest ace from local so we don't mess up with https
2013-06-11 15:27:26 +10:00
Sam
eed5875505
fix bug with wrapping
2013-06-11 15:27:26 +10:00
Sam
a92bb46966
edit date to use formatter, compensate for invalid local time (at least don't blow up)
2013-06-11 15:27:26 +10:00
Robin Ward
850123dce8
FIX: User Pill errors
2013-06-10 18:51:25 -04:00
Neil Lalonde
78000fe870
Fix category delete
2013-06-10 14:20:06 -04:00
Robin Ward
0d83f373b8
Add some logic to jumpTop/jumpBottom when best of is enabled
2013-06-10 13:07:54 -04:00
Robin Ward
ad6705cca7
Update Ember to latest master (RC5)
2013-06-10 10:14:42 -04:00
Sam
2d14b54096
Merge pull request #988 from chrishunt/add-dynamic-favicon
...
Add 'dynamic favicon' setting
2013-06-09 16:13:54 -07:00
Chris Hunt
3bdfdd7c04
Redirect when can_edit === false or undefined
2013-06-07 22:09:51 -07:00
Chris Hunt
af1c14939e
Add 'dynamic favicon' setting
2013-06-07 17:15:49 -07:00
Robin Ward
eab38b5c34
JSHint fix :(
...
)
2013-06-07 18:08:08 -04:00
Robin Ward
b46b533e70
Create the composer view with the defaultContainer. This is in prep for redeploying
...
on RC5. Ideally we'll change how the composer is instantiated altogether but that will
have to wait for a future release.
2013-06-07 18:04:51 -04:00
Sam
a6f67d85eb
also should have caught this earlier
2013-06-08 07:47:48 +10:00
Sam
1e725629cd
no idea how this was even working
2013-06-08 07:45:45 +10:00
Robin Ward
fa4cfa1269
ScreenTrack refactor - removes logic from TopicView didInsertElement
2013-06-07 17:20:10 -04:00
Robin Ward
cdc3a57a91
Merge pull request #983 from ZogStriP/fix-combobox-not-working-properly
...
FIX: combobox were not working properly
2013-06-07 12:08:04 -07:00
Régis Hanol
3f5c12ca1b
FIX: combobox were not working properly
2013-06-07 20:45:31 +02:00
Robin Ward
668a4a3042
Move MessageBus subscribing/unsubscribing out of view
2013-06-07 14:28:33 -04:00
Robin Ward
3ae72259a6
Merge pull request #979 from iancmyers/strong-parameters
...
All parameters for #create in PostsController pass through strong_parameters
2013-06-07 09:17:29 -07:00
Robin Ward
7c715e76e8
Refactor: Light pass of didInsertElement calls of views
2013-06-07 12:13:46 -04:00
Ian Christian Myers
b61e10f9ad
All parameters for #create in PostsController pass through strong_parameters.
...
We are now explicitly whitelisting all parameters for Post creation. A nice side-effect is that it cleans up the #create action in PostsController. We can now trust that all parameters entering PostCreator are of a safe scalar type.
2013-06-07 01:29:25 -07:00
Sam
d1784f1f87
more moment goodness
2013-06-07 18:27:42 +10:00
Sam
000847b8d2
date helper uses the formatter now
2013-06-07 18:27:42 +10:00
Sam
5fa20ce357
more progress towards full migration to moment.js
2013-06-07 18:27:42 +10:00
Chris Hunt
d50a598e62
Notify admin of successful user approval
2013-06-06 18:37:25 -07:00
Sam
7ff42377ac
$.browser is gone from jQuery 1.9 ... and this is a check for ie7 and 6 ... don't care
2013-06-07 10:38:39 +10:00
Sam
6ed79e66bc
jquery 1.9.1 upgrade ... remove jquery rails
2013-06-07 09:12:46 +10:00
Sam
11afa0c11b
work in progress migrate to moment
2013-06-07 08:49:22 +10:00
Robin Ward
b758427572
Fix annoying jshint :)
2013-06-06 16:48:15 -04:00
Robin Ward
ba5f2d23a1
Fixed ContainerView code to build views correctly
2013-06-06 16:45:25 -04:00
Robin Ward
526f2af69a
FIX: Touch events conflicted on mobile safari with {{action}}
s, preventing admin menu
...
option from working. Mobile Safari works with click so this seems to fix it.
2013-06-06 13:16:36 -04:00
Robin Ward
06e83c9e6a
FIX: Hitting enter while the invite dialog is up should submit the form, not refresh the
...
entire page :)
2013-06-06 12:06:43 -04:00
Robin Ward
a3d62fdf69
Temporarily roll back ember rc5. We identified some things we need to fix.
2013-06-06 01:25:43 -04:00
Robin Ward
7b70330e85
FIX: Javascript errors when navigating to some topics
2013-06-05 20:53:48 -04:00
Sam
2ca734c118
Merge pull request #964 from chrishunt/exclusive-club
...
Add 'invite only' site setting
2013-06-05 16:38:47 -07:00
Robin Ward
0b97ea6345
Better HTML emails, smarter email digests, new email section in admin with digest preview
2013-06-05 17:47:25 -04:00
Robin Ward
eb673c7e5d
Merge pull request #963 from chrishunt/chrishunt/refresh-user-list-after-approval
...
Refresh admin user list after approval
2013-06-05 12:07:49 -07:00
Stephan Kaag
469bf044c3
Remove superfluous }
2013-06-05 21:54:07 +03:00
Chris Hunt
8f14e46964
Hide registration on login modal if 'invite only'
2013-06-05 11:06:54 -07:00
Robin Ward
7d089fdfb5
FIX: Compile templates properly with the latest handlebars
2013-06-05 14:00:02 -04:00
Robin Ward
07cd87f941
FIX: Couldn't navigate to Categories list via link
2013-06-05 12:40:06 -04:00
Robin Ward
a0bd51862e
Upgrade Ember to RC5. Disabled a deprecation warning that I believe is in error.
2013-06-05 12:07:18 -04:00
Chris Hunt
f05c30ab8d
Refresh admin user list after approval
2013-06-05 08:57:25 -07:00
Neil Lalonde
f0d4a38433
Admin flags UI shows when it's loading and when there are no results
2013-06-05 10:24:50 -04:00
Sam
2509d0f4fa
Merge pull request #959 from chrishunt/chrishunt/login-required-fixes
...
'login required' site setting improvements
2013-06-04 19:09:40 -07:00
Sam
93be638d93
message format is awesome, remove 0 unread and 0 new links.
2013-06-05 12:04:54 +10:00